Definition and explanation

Stevens-Johnson Syndrome is a life-threatening skin condition that can be triggered by certain medications, including phenobarbital. Symptoms start as flu-like illness and rapidly progress to widespread rashes, blistering, and organ involvement. Understanding the definition helps sufferers pursue claims for medical expenses, pain and suffering, and related losses.

Glossary and key terms

Use this glossary description to quickly understand terms used in drug injury litigation, including causation, notice, settlement, and verdict implications in phenobarbital SJS claims within California courts.

Adverse Drug Reaction

An adverse drug reaction is an unwanted harm formally linked to a medication rather than to another condition. In phenobarbital cases, researchers and clinicians investigate whether the drug contributed to a serious skin reaction like SJS.

Causation in drug injury cases

Causation in a drug injury case means proving that the medication contributed to the injury. In SJS claims, this involves medical records, timelines, and sometimes expert testimony linking phenobarbital exposure to the reaction.

Settlement

A settlement is an agreement to resolve a claim without a trial, often involving compensation for medical bills, pain and suffering, and lost wages. In phenobarbital SJS matters, settlements can reflect medical costs and future care needs.

Lawsuit timeline

A lawsuit timeline outlines steps from intake to resolution, including documentation, requests for records, discovery, negotiations, and potential court events. Timelines can vary by complexity and court availability in California.

Stevens-Johnson syndrome (SJS) represents a severe and potentially life-threatening condition that impacts the skin and mucous membranes. When this condition progresses to its most dangerous variant, toxic epidermal necrolysis (TEN), mortality rates can range from 30-80%. In most cases, these reactions stem from adverse responses to pharmaceutical medications.
